#f3bd73 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f3bd73 is composed of 95.3% red, 74.1%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.2%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 34.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 70.2%. #f3bd73 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e6 with #e77b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#f3bd73 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f3bd73 has RGB values of R:243, G:189,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.53,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15973747.

Shades and Tints of #f3bd73
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050300 is the darkest color, while #fef9f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f3bd73
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b9b4ad is the less saturated color, while #ffbf67 is the most saturated one.
